Enhancing Road Durability with Asphalt Testing

Road networks are the lifelines of any economy, and their longevity depends on the quality of materials and the accuracy of performance evaluations. One such advanced tool is the Asphalt Beam Fatigue Test Equipment, which measures the fatigue life of asphalt mixtures under repeated loading. This testing method helps engineers predict pavement performance, allowing them to design roads that can withstand heavy traffic and environmental stress for years to come.

By simulating real-world load conditions, asphalt fatigue testing provides invaluable data for optimizing mix design, improving road safety, and reducing long-term maintenance costs.

Reliable Concrete Testing for Structural Integrity

Concrete remains the backbone of modern construction, making quality control vital. A trusted Concrete Testing Equipment Supplier can provide everything from slump test apparatus to compression machines, ensuring accurate measurement of concrete’s strength, workability, and durability.

In addition to standard testing methods, engineers are increasingly using Concrete NDT Testing Equipment to evaluate structures without causing damage. Non-destructive testing (NDT) techniques, such as ultrasonic pulse velocity and rebound hammer testing, allow for quick, precise assessments, helping engineers detect flaws and ensure compliance with safety standards while preserving the integrity of the material.

Advanced Groundwater and Soil Analysis

Water seepage and soil behavior play critical roles in the stability of infrastructure projects. Tools like the Groundwater Seepage Analysis Software enable engineers to model and predict groundwater movement in three dimensions. This helps in the design of effective drainage systems, flood prevention strategies, and sustainable water management solutions.

For soil strength and deformation studies, the Large Size Triaxial system is a breakthrough. It can simulate stress conditions in large soil specimens, providing crucial insights into soil mechanics for applications like foundation design, embankments, and underground constructions.

Resilient Modulus Testing for Pavement Performance

A key factor in pavement design is the ability of materials to recover after being subjected to repeated traffic loads. The Resilient Modulus Test Apparatus measures this property, allowing engineers to assess the elasticity and load-bearing capacity of road materials. By understanding how materials behave under cyclic loading, infrastructure designers can create pavements that maintain performance and resist deformation over their service life.

Safety Barriers for Roadside Protection

While material testing ensures the quality of construction, roadside safety is equally important. A Wire Rope Safety Barrier system is an effective solution for preventing severe accidents on highways. Its flexible yet strong construction absorbs impact energy, minimizing vehicle damage and protecting passengers. These barriers are widely used in modern road safety designs, offering both durability and ease of installation.

Advanced Concrete Imaging and Tomography

Inspection technology has evolved far beyond simple visual checks. The Mira Concrete Tomography system uses impact-echo methods combined with advanced 3D imaging to visualize the internal structure of concrete elements. This non-invasive technology helps detect voids, delaminations, and other internal defects without drilling or damaging the structure. Such innovations are critical in extending the lifespan of bridges, tunnels, and buildings.

Rock Testing for Geotechnical Applications

Large-scale infrastructure projects often require detailed analysis of rock formations, especially for tunneling, mining, and foundation works. The Rock Polyaxial Testing System allows engineers to simulate stress conditions from multiple directions, closely replicating natural geomechanical environments. This enables a better understanding of rock strength, deformation behavior, and failure mechanisms, which is essential for designing safe and stable structures in challenging geological conditions.
